Description : GADD 153 has been described as a growth arrest and DNA damage-inducible gene that encodes a C/EBP-related nuclear protein. GADD153 expression is induced by a variety of cellular stresses, inducing nutrient deprivation and merabolic perturbations. GADD153 functions to block cells in G1 to S phase in cell cycle progression and acts by dimerizing with other C/EBP proteins to direct GADD153 dimers away from "classical" C/EBP binding sites, recognizing instead unique "nonclassical" sites.

Cell viability, apoptosis, and autophagy rate in human HGG cells after GADD153 complementary DNA overexpression. Bar graphs showing a significant decrease in cell viability after overexpression of GADD153 complementary DNA in U87 (A) and T98G (E) HGG cells. A significant increase in apoptotic (B and F) and autophagic (C and G) rate was also seen. *P < .05, Student's t-test compared with vector. Western blotting showing increased expression of CHOP/GADD153, apoptosis (cleaved caspase-3), and autophagy (LC3II) markers in U87 (D) and T98G (H) cells after transient transfection of CHOP/GADD153.
